Babuza
A language of Taiwan
| Population | 4 (2000 S. Wurm). Ethnic population: 35. |
| Region | West central coast and inland, Tatu and Choshui rivers and beyond. |

| Alternate names | Babusa, Favorlang, Favorlangsch, Jaborlang, Poavosa |
| Dialects | Poavosa, Taokas. Taokas dialect has no remaining speakers. |
| Classification | Austronesian, Western Plains, Central Western Plains |
| Language use | Home. Adults only. Neutral attitude. |
| Language development | Bible portions. |
| Comments | Sinicized. Nearly extinct. |
